Lepidosperma semiteres, commonly known as the wire rapier-sedge, is a distinctive perennial sedge native to Australia. This species is a member of the Cyperaceae family, a group of grass-like plants often found in wet or damp environments. The wire rapier-sedge is characterized by its tough, wiry, and erect growth habit, forming dense clumps that can reach heights of up to 1.5 meters. Its foliage consists of stiff, linear leaves that are typically dark green and can be quite sharp-edged, contributing to its common name. The leaves arise from the base of the plant, giving it a tufted appearance.
The inflorescences of Lepidosperma semiteres are borne on erect, triangular stems, often exceeding the height of the foliage. These are typically dense, spike-like clusters of small, inconspicuous flowers, which are characteristic of sedges. The flowers are wind-pollinated and are followed by small, nut-like fruits known as achenes. The seeds are dispersed by wind and water. The root system is fibrous and robust, helping to anchor the plant in its preferred substrates.
Lepidosperma semiteres is primarily found in the coastal regions of southeastern Australia, extending from New South Wales through Victoria and into Tasmania. It thrives in a variety of habitats, commonly occurring in sandy soils, coastal heaths, woodlands, and along the edges of swamps and waterways. It prefers well-drained to moderately moist conditions and can tolerate a range of light exposures, from full sun to partial shade. While it is adapted to its native environment, it can also be cultivated in gardens, particularly in areas with similar climatic conditions. Its tolerance for sandy soils and coastal exposure makes it a suitable choice for xeriscaping or for stabilizing sandy areas.
Ecologically, Lepidosperma semiteres plays a role in its native ecosystems by providing habitat and contributing to soil stabilization. Its dense growth can offer shelter for small invertebrates and birds. While not widely cultivated for ornamental purposes compared to some other native Australian plants, its architectural form and resilience make it an interesting addition to native plant gardens, particularly in coastal or sandy landscapes. Its tough, fibrous nature has historically led to some use in traditional crafts, though this is not a significant economic or cultural application today. The plant's adaptations, such as its stiff, leathery leaves, help it to survive in exposed coastal environments where it faces salt spray and sandy, nutrient-poor soils.
